Flühli SW climb

A short, very steep climb above Flühli in Luzern. At 3.5 TEP it sits in the easier half of the catalogue. Its steepest 500 metres run at 26.2% and start 321 m in, in the middle of the climb, so pace the first part. Most runners need 9 to 16 minutes. It is graded demanding mountain hiking: expect sections where you watch every step. Southwest-facing: it gets the afternoon heat and clears of snow early. The nearest named summit, Schafmatt at 1,979 m, is 314 m away.
